A. R. was imminent. Johannesburg, c. 1900 (www.geheugenvannederland.nl) When Johannesburg was founded in 1886, public education in the Z. A. R. was controlled by the Education and learning Regulation of 1882. The earlier Education Law of 1874 had supplied that federal government colleges in the Z. A. R. (just a handful of such colleges remained in presence) were to be non-denominational which guideline was to be in Dutch or English, at the will of moms and dads.
In 1886, Pope Leo XIII constituted the Transvaal an independent prefecture under the jurisdiction of the Rt Revd Odilon Monginoux of the Oblates of Mary Spotless, that was the initial Prefect Apostolic of the Transvaal. On 20 July 1886, Fr John de Lacy O. M. I. visited the Rand. He put on the government for a tract big sufficient to fit a church, an institution and homes for the instructors.

The college moved to Doornfontein in 1895, and came to be called the East End Convent. In 1905, the Holy Family siblings additionally established Parktown Convent College (now Holy Family members College). On 2 November 1887, Miss Frances Buckland began teaching in a house on the edge of Jeppe and Rissik streets.
On 11 June 1887, the Revd John Thomas Darragh, the first Anglican clergyman to be stationed on the Rand, had shown up from Kimberley. A mammoth tome on the history of Christianity in Africa observes briefly: 'The Anglican community at Kimberley was lucky to have as its leader J. T.
He had actually won a scholarship to The Royal School, Armagh, whence he had increased to Trinity University, Dublin, as a Foundation Scholar. Right here he had actually identified himself, being Classical Hebrew and Divinity Prizeman, and had come to be an Other of Trinity College. He was blessed in 1880, and ended up being curate of All Saints, Grangegorman, Area Dublin.

He was an energised and resourceful male that quickly dove himself heart and spirit into the life of the growing and bustling mining area. It was not just the Anglican parishioners who acquired benefit, for Darragh worked unstintingly among all sectors of the town. As an example, the tiny community of Greek Orthodox settlers in Johannesburg had no archimandrite, and so approached Darragh to perform marriage and baptismal rites.

Marist Brothers' University got such a great track record that some officials of the staunchly Protestant Z. A. R. government enlisted their boys as students at this Catholic institution. During the Anglo-Boer South African Battle (1899-1902), the institution's enrolment dropped, yet by 1905 numbers were back to 500 and the college was promoting the fact that it had 'ample stabling for students' equines'.
In 1892, the Superintendent of Education, Dr N. Mansvelt, compiled a record in which he specified that some teachers in the Transvaal can not mean the words 'Pretoria' and 'Potchefstroom', and did not recognize the difference in between a noun and an adjective. In the exact same year, the Education and learning Legislation was amended to provide that all instructors in institutions obtaining government aids had to be members of a Protestant church; institutions also can not get aids in respect of Jewish and Catholic students.

St Cyprian's was at first approved a state aid, yet this was terminated when a federal government inspection exposed that the institution had lots of coloured and 'indigenous' children amongst its students, sharing workdesks with white children. Regardless of the withdrawal of the aid, the college took care of to endure.
After the War, it was reopened and run by Sisters of the Culture browse around here of St Margaret (informally recognized as the East Grinstead Siblings, with recommendation to their convent in East Grinstead, Sussex). Undaunted by the contretemps with the authorities regarding St Cyprian's and its subsidy, Darragh started Willpower College in November 1891.
